Hutt replaced by Gibbons as Welsh health and social services minister

Welsh minister for health and social services Jane Hutt has been replaced by Brian Gibbons after six years in the job, it was announced today, writes Clare Jerrom.

Gibbons, the deputy economic development and transport minister, is a member of the British Medical Association and previously served as deputy minister for health and social services.

First minister Rhodri Morgan said he was confident that Gibbons had the necessary experience to build on the platform Hutt has established.

Morgan has asked Hutt to take another key cabinet position as business manager where she will help to lead the Welsh Assembly government’s agenda.

Karen Sinclair, who was previously business manager, will continue as chief whip and attending the cabinet.
